Least Common Multiple of 80880 and 80887 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 80880 and 80887, than apply into the LCM equation.

GCF(80880,80887) = 1
LCM(80880,80887) = ( 80880 × 80887) / 1
LCM(80880,80887) = 6542140560 / 1
LCM(80880,80887) = 6542140560
